Personal Information and Early Days

To give you a clearer picture of Morgan Wallen, here are some basic details about him. This information just helps put things into perspective a little, giving you a quick snapshot of his personal side, so you can sort of get a feel for the person behind the songs.

Full NameMorgan Cole Wallen
BornMay 13, 1993
BirthplaceSneedville, Tennessee, U.S.
Musical StyleCountry, Country Pop
Active Years2014–present
Record LabelsBig Loud, Mercury Nashville

He got his start, like many musicians, by performing and trying to get his voice heard. He was on a television singing competition show some years ago, which gave him a bit of a platform, and from there, his career really started to pick up speed. What's the Story Behind Morgan Wallen's "Smile" Song?

The song "Smile" by Morgan Wallen is, in a way, a surprise gift that arrived right at the close of 2024. It just sort of appeared on New Year's Eve, without any big announcements beforehand. This kind of release is pretty cool because it feels like a personal share, a direct offering to his listeners. It's not part of a huge album rollout; it's more like a quiet moment he wanted to share with everyone, so it's a bit special in that regard.

The song itself, when you listen closely, feels like a continuation of some stories he's been telling in his music throughout 2024. He put out a couple of other songs earlier that year, "Lies Lies Lies" in July and "Love Somebody" in October, and "Smile" seems to pick up where those left off, in some respects. It's as if he's creating a sort of musical narrative, with each song adding another piece to a larger picture about feelings and relationships, which is a very interesting way to release music, I think.

People have described "Smile" as a thoughtful ballad, a bit on the quieter, more serious side. It's not a party anthem; it's more for those times when you're thinking about things, maybe a little reflective. It touches on themes of love and the mixed feelings that can come with relationships, those moments that are both sweet and a little sad at the same time. Unpacking the Lyric Moments in "Smile Morgan Wallen"

One of the most memorable parts of "Smile" is a line that Morgan Wallen sings in the chorus. He croons, "It was good to see you smile / even if it was just for the picture." This line, you know, it really captures a specific kind of feeling. It speaks to seeing someone happy, even if that happiness is just for a fleeting moment or for show. It hints at a deeper story, perhaps of a time when smiles were less common, or maybe not quite as genuine. It's a pretty powerful image, honestly, and it makes you wonder about the full story behind it.

There's another bit in the song that paints a vivid scene: "I can't remember the last time you looked as happy as you did tonight your tipsy friend grabbed that bartender gave him her phone and pulled us over there with her."
